#1fe1b7 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#1fe1b7 is composed of 12.2% red, 88.2% green and 71.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 18.7%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 167 degrees, a saturation of 76.4% and a lightness of 50.2%. #1fe1b7 color hex could be obtained by blending #3effff with #00c36f.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#effdfa is the lightest one.
